Chapter 363: Asking One More Time

"Hu Ya!" Yu Yaqing didn't want to fall out with her former teammate. She took a step forward and sternly ordered her again, "Hand over the key!"

Hu Ya continued to retreat, then suddenly turned and ran towards the corridor!

Yu Yaqing raised her leg to chase, but was a step too slow!

Hu Ya ran into her room and slammed the door shut!

"Hu Ya!" Yu Yaqing pounded on the door. "Come out! Don't be confused! The key is likely a trap!"

The person inside the room didn't make a sound.

The others were all awakened by the noise, and one by one they walked out of their rooms, asking Yu Yaqing in confusion:

"What's wrong? What happened to Hu Ya?"

Bai Youwei also rubbed her ears and asked sleepily, "What are you arguing about?"

Yu Yaqing felt somewhat embarrassed. Although Hu Ya's actions were her personal behavior, she was, after all, her team member, and Yu Yaqing felt she had some responsibility.

"Hu Ya has the key, and she might want to do something…" Yu Yaqing pursed her lips and said in a low voice, "I'm worried she'll mess things up."

"Did she come out in the middle of the night to open the door and find that it couldn't be opened?" Bai Youwei yawned and said lazily, "Let her do what she wants. Anyway, we can't escape unless the Duke dies. One more of her doesn't make a difference. Let's all go back to sleep."

She wheeled herself back into her room and closed the door to sleep.

Su Man and Zhu Zhu exchanged glances and also returned to their rooms.

Yu Yaqing looked at their backs, then looked at the closed door in front of her… She raised her hand and knocked on the door again.

Bang, bang.

There was no sound from inside the door.

Yu Yaqing thought for a moment and said to the door, "Hu Ya, no matter what, I hope you can think about it again and don't be bewitched by the game."

After she finished speaking, there was still no movement.

Yu Yaqing stood in front of the door for a while, then turned and went back to her room.

Hu Ya's back was pressed against the door panel as she slowly slid down to sit. She lowered her head and looked at the key in her hand.

"What else is there to think about…" She stared at the key, murmuring distractedly, "If we can clear the game by killing the Duke, I can clear the game with them. If the Duke doesn't die… they will definitely not survive. Only I… only I will live to the last day."

She closed her eyes and clenched the key in her hand.

"I can't trust them… The only person I can rely on is myself."

The next morning, Bai Youwei woke up early.

Calculating the time, this was already the third morning she had been in the game. It was time to end it.

She wheeled herself to the dining room.

The Inspector was setting up breakfast, which was still simple milk and dry bread. Despite its simplicity, it tirelessly adjusted the placement of the plates and the angle of the food, like a severe obsessive-compulsive patient.

The others hadn't arrived yet.

Bai Youwei first took a bite of the dry bread, which tasted like chewing wood chips.

She put down the bread and drank half a glass of milk. Fortunately, the milk was fresh.

"Actually, there's something I've been concerned about…" she said, "As a game exclusively for women, isn't it a bit too violent if the condition for clearing the game is to kill the Duke?"

The Inspector looked at her quietly.

Bai Youwei said, "After all, violence isn't something women are good at. But if it's not killing the Duke, then the only other way is to find the key."

At this point, she paused and raised her eyes to look at the Inspector.

"But this method is even more unreliable…" She stared at the face that resembled a handsome man from a manga and said calmly, "Because I can't imagine how a game can continue if the Inspector deliberately gives out wrong information?"

"The Inspector is always correct." It finally spoke. "There will only be situations where players misunderstand, not situations where the Inspector is wrong."

Bai Youwei said, "Then I'll ask you one more time, is the condition for clearing the game to find the key?"

The Inspector fell silent.

After a moment, it answered, "The condition for clearing the game is to become the last bride."

Bai Youwei smiled faintly, "Thanks."
